The Evolution of Definitions

Definitions are not static entities; they evolve over time as our knowledge and perspectives change. What was once considered a definitive explanation may become outdated or incomplete as new information emerges. This dynamic nature of definitions is beautifully captured in the words of Albert Einstein, who said, "The important thing is not to stop questioning. Curiosity has its own reason for existing." This quote emphasizes the continuous process of redefining and refining our understanding.

One of the most profound examples of evolving definitions is in the field of science. Scientific theories and definitions are constantly being revised as new discoveries are made. For instance, the definition of "planet" has changed over the years, with Pluto's demotion from planetary status being a notable example. Quotes about definition in science often reflect this ongoing quest for knowledge and understanding.

The Role of Context in Definitions

Context plays a crucial role in shaping definitions. The same word can have different meanings in different contexts. For example, the word "bank" can refer to a financial institution or the side of a river. Understanding the context is essential for accurate interpretation. Quotes about definition often highlight the importance of context in communication. For instance, the quote by Ludwig Wittgenstein, "The meaning of a word is its use in the language," underscores the idea that words derive their meaning from how they are used in specific contexts.

In literature, context is particularly important. Authors often use words in unique ways to convey deeper meanings. For example, in George Orwell's "1984," the term "doublethink" is defined as the ability to hold two contradictory beliefs simultaneously. This definition is specific to the dystopian world Orwell created and would not have the same meaning in a different context. Quotes about definition in literature often explore the rich and complex ways in which language can be used to convey meaning.
